By: LunarEmerald http://www.hsmagazine.net/2012/08/if-you-had-a-10-psn-card/#comment-204071 Fri, 24 Aug 2012 11:30:15 +0000 http://www.hsmagazine.net/?p=35316#comment-204071 I think it’s more important to spend the $10 on things you actually want instead of buying those bargain bundles.

$5 for Hollywood Hills and $5 for clothing you want. $5 is enough to dress yourself nice and Hollywood Hills is the best personal space in terms of value. Pool, hottub, two stories, plenty of wall space and EOD for movies and radio. There’s plenty of free furniture rewards for furnishing.

That’s what I would recommend for newcomers.
